Adamson, Kim A., M.D.
License #5086 |
|
|
|
09/30/1987 |
|
Dr. Adamson entered into a
Stipulation with the Investigative Committee of the Nevada State Board of
Medical Examiners whereby it was ordered that he enter into a contract with
the Impaired Physician's Committee for seven years, that he provide the
Board with random urinalyses, that he provide the IC with status reports of
his treatment and progress, and that he shall not prescribe any controlled
substances until the successful completion of his contract. |
|
|
|
12/14/1987 |
|
The Nevada State Board of Medical
Examiners filed a formal complaint against Dr. Adamson alleging dependency
on controlled substances, and inability to practice medicine with reasonable
skill and safety. |
|
|
|
07/08/1988 |
|
The Board ordered that Dr.
Adamson's license in the state of Nevada be revoked, the revocation stayed
and he be placed on probation for 7 years; that he enter into contract with
the Impaired Physician's Committee for 7 years, submit to random urinalyses,
provide reports to the Board of his status, and shall not dispense any
controlled substances. |
|
|
|
09/20/1991 |
|
The Board ordered that Dr.
Adamson immediately enroll in the Ridgeview Treatment Program in the state
of Georgia or a comparable treatment program for substance abuse treatment. |
|
|
|
08/10/1994 |
|
Hearing to consider lifting stay of
revocation for non-compliance with probation imposed by Board. |
|
|
|
|
11/09/1994 |
|
The Board ordered that Dr. Adamson's license
to practice medicine in the state of Nevada
be revoked, the revocation stayed and he be
placed on probation for 10 years, he shall
enter into contract with the Northern Nevada
Physicians' Aid Committee for 10 years, he
shall work in a board approved urban area,
shall pay for all administrative costs and
lab testing, pay a fine of $2,500.00, and he
shall not dispense any controlled
substances. |
|
|
|
05/05/1995 |
|
The Board summarily suspended Dr. Adamson's
license to practice medicine in the state of
Nevada pending proceedings because he was
working in an area not approved by the
Board, a violation of the November 9, 1994
Order. |
|
|
|
06/29/1995 |
|
The Board ordered that Dr. Adamson's license
to practice medicine in the state of Nevada
remain suspended until November 5, 1995 at
which time the November 9, 1994 order terms
and conditions shall be in full force and
effect and he shall pay all administrative
costs. |
|
|
|
12/28/1995 |
|
The Board ordered that Dr. Adamson pay the
previously ordered amount of $2,000.00 to
the board by January 15, 1996 to cover
administrative costs and fines. |
|
|
|
01/05/1996 |
|
The Board ordered that Dr. Adamson could
return to private practice in Fallon, Nevada
with the terms and conditions as set in the
November 9, 1994 Findings of Facts, Conclusions
of Law and Order. |
|
|
|
01/15/1997 |
|
The Board Summarily Suspended Dr.
Adamson's license to practice medicine in
the state of Nevada pending disciplinary proceedings,
based on the allegation that he was in violation of the
January 5, 1996 Order. |
|
|
|
01/27/1997 |
|
The Board revoked Dr. Adamson's
license to practice medicine in the state of
Nevada. |
